Ruef Trial Closing Arguments Attack Prosecution
In San Francisco on December 8 a bitter closing argument attacked Francis J. Heney and the graft prosecutors. The attorney for Ruef denounced the Schmitz board and likened Ruef to Caesar killed for others' ambitions. He attacked Spreckles for funding graft, compared Gallagher to a prosecution parrot, and questioned Spreckles empire and immunity claims.

Wife of Governor-Elect Reports Husband Improves Some
Mrs Cosgrove wife of the Washington governor elect stated her husband is better today than yesterday though still very ill and doctors describe his condition as a typical form of Brights disease with fluctuating strength. She denied rumors of near death and cautioned against plans to return to Washington as his health remains unstable.

Dead Engineer on OrientAL Limited Throttle Dead
The Oriental Limited carrying only first class passengers ran many miles with a dead engineer George P Irving at the throttle. The fireman stopped the train near Minneapolis after seeing the engineer’s fatal head injury from an obstruction.

Roosevelt's Final Message Urges Currency Reform and Combating Unions
The 1908 presidential address to Congress reviews the economy and money supply gains since 1901, notes currency imperfections, and praises treasury relief efforts. It advocates interstate commerce control, warns against strict Sherman Act prohibitions, and calls for compulsory agency oversight and public disclosure of corporate actions.

Boys in Trouble Moon Are Arrested in Lenet
Otto Stull, about 18, was arrested last evening on charges including bicycle theft from N K Woeast, stealing sacks, and placing a chain across a sidewalk causing falls. He was arraigned before Judge Henry and will be tried tomorrow. if convicted, he faces state reform school. Stull implicated Ira Moon, who is sought by warrant.

Woman suicide at Napa state asylum
Mia Lena Severance wife of former State Senator Severance of San Francisco hanged herself in the Napa state insane asylum yesterday. She had been committed three weeks earlier. She climbed a chair and used a picture button on the wall, then kicked away the chair and died from strangulation.

Bank Robbery At East Side Bank In Portland
Three unmasked men held up the East Side bank in Portland yesterday afternoon, taking about $17,000 in gold, currency, and valuables. A horse and buggy rig abandoned nearby, plus $200 in mud near the bank, were found as investigators searched the city. Police report shots fired. no trace of the robbers as of this morning.

Anonymous letter blames murder and assassination on local option push
An anonymous note to Angus Mower in La Grande Oregon claims murder and assassination stem from local option enforcement. The writer, using a typewritten sheet, urges restraint and hints at a warning to the justice of the peace and his associates.
